Output 3f3442b53b69a00230da6402fb153c50944ee91d828336e68e9ffb3d99530e91:11

value
28216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 795fd489550a52563db7d63bd4b1cfaa6540d641 OP_EQUALVERIFY OP_CHECKSIG
address
1C4mZcVYLWxrS4621DZKyr1VottHkviuM2
transaction
3f3442b53b69a00230da6402fb153c50944ee91d828336e68e9ffb3d99530e91
spent
true